How Do Motherboards Affect the Compatibility of Components with AMD Ryzen 7 9800X3D?
Socket Type: The Ryzen 7 9800X3D requires an AM5 socket, which is specifically designed to accommodate this generation of AMD processors. Using a motherboard with the correct socket type ensures proper fitment and optimal communication between the CPU and the motherboard.
BIOS Updates: Manufacturers often release BIOS updates to improve compatibility and performance with new processors. It’s important to check if the motherboard supports the Ryzen 7 9800X3D out of the box or requires a BIOS update after purchase.
Power Delivery System: A motherboard with a strong VRM (Voltage Regulator Module) design ensures stable power delivery to the CPU, particularly under heavy loads or when overclocking. This can prevent thermal throttling and improve the longevity of your components.
Memory Support: The motherboard should support the RAM specifications that match or exceed the Ryzen 7 9800X3D’s requirements, including dual-channel configurations and high-speed DDR5 memory. This support can lead to better system performance and efficiency.
Expansion Slots and I/O Options: A motherboard with ample PCIe slots allows for future upgrades like additional GPUs or NVMe storage devices. Furthermore, having a variety of USB ports and other I/O options enhances the versatility of your build, allowing for greater connectivity with peripherals.
